Hi there, PixiePower... :)

If you buy between 150-209 points in DVC, you'll get 5 free nights to use between July 1,2002 and July 1, 2003 at any Disney Resort (except the GF and the All-Stars)... You get 7 free nights if you book 210+... I think you get more if you book 260+ but don' tknow the exact point value and how many free nights...

You can book the free stay at the earliest 7 months in advance, and you have to book it by June 2003... It has to be a consecutive stay, I am told, so you can't use 3 nights in October for free and then 2 nights in February.... for example.

And there are some black out times - mainly the most popular times to be in WDW - Christmas Vacay, Feb, March, April vacation weeks, etc.

They offered this incentive only with the purchase of BCV. The other incentive is to receive $5 per point purchased and apply it to the down payment. The main reason for the incentives was because the resort was being prepurchased and couldn't be used until July. Also, because they have one less year of use in the program. With WLV, they were offering a $5 per point buyback program only. Otherwise, you kept your points for use in the same use year or banked them. Couldn't tell from your post if that was an option, but you're right. Anyone who wants to buy should take advantage of the incentives for this one before May or June. I heard the incentives will be disappearing soon. We're close to that opening date.
